    FMG9s aren't broken. Use your eyes and ears, common sense and more importantly your weapon. FMG9 users can be easily countered by shooting them to death. Same goes for everything else you listed. See, this joke of an argument can be used for anything.

     

    In all seriousness though, all you listed are ineffective on long range. Don't get into CQC with someone using these and you won't have a problem.

     

    In Modern Warfare 2 Cold-blooded had a decent counter, the Heartbeat Sensor. And the choice between more bullet damage and UAV immunity.

     

    In Black Ops Ghost had a decent counter, the Blackbird.

     

    In MW3 there are no decent counters.

     

    Recon is not a decent counter. You have very few explosives that you can't even resupply. The effect only lasts 10 seconds (5 if he has Dead Silence), and you have to actually know where the Assassin user is to tag him.

     

    Recon Drone? 10 kills with the support package and the effect lasts one life. Again, you need to manually tag them. Not good enough of a counter.
